Case Study Background
PrimeRealty Developers Ltd., a publicly listed real estate company headquartered in Gurugram, is one of Northern India's fastest-growing property developers. With a portfolio spanning residential, commercial, and mixed-use developments, the company has experienced rapid growth over the past decade, expanding from 300 to over 2,500 employees across 50+ properties in the Delhi-NCR region.
Mr. Rajiv Sharma, CEO of PrimeRealty Developers, has recently unveiled "Vision 2035" – an ambitious growth strategy focused on sustainable development, technological innovation, and expansion into tier-2 cities. "Our infrastructure is our foundation," emphasizes Mr. Sharma. "To realize our Vision 2035, we need to transform our IT infrastructure to support smart buildings, IoT integration, and unified data platforms."
Mr. Vikram Malhotra, CTO at PrimeRealty, has identified significant challenges in the company's infrastructure ecosystem:
- Legacy systems across 50+ properties creating data silos and integration challenges
- Inadequate security measures exposing vulnerabilities across property management systems
- Inconsistent technology stacks across different projects and locations
- Difficulty scaling infrastructure to support rapid expansion
- Lack of real-time data integration between property management, sales, and operations systems
- Need for smart building infrastructure supporting IoT devices and automation
"We need to move beyond fragmented property-specific systems to a unified infrastructure that enables greater operational agility," explains Mr. Malhotra. "This isn't just about implementing new technology; it's about fundamentally rethinking how we architect and manage our IT infrastructure."
With the board's approval, Mr. Malhotra has initiated a strategic project to transform PrimeRealty's infrastructure architecture as the cornerstone of the company's digital transformation journey.
Implementation Challenges
As a consultant engaged to support this implementation, you must address the following questions, considering both technical aspects and organizational change requirements.
Case Study Questions
- Cloud Migration Strategy
PrimeRealty currently uses on-premises systems across 50+ properties with varying technology maturity. How would you design a comprehensive cloud migration strategy that supports both current operations and Mr. Sharma's Vision 2035? Outline specific migration phases, cloud architecture patterns, and considerations for hybrid cloud deployment.
- IoT Integration Architecture
Smart buildings require integration of thousands of IoT devices for HVAC, security, lighting, and energy management. How would you design an IoT architecture that can scale across multiple properties while ensuring security, reliability, and real-time data processing? Include edge computing considerations and data aggregation strategies.
- Data Platform Modernization
PrimeRealty stores property data, customer information, and operational metrics across multiple siloed systems. What approach would you recommend for designing a unified data platform that enables real-time analytics and supports business intelligence needs? Detail your data architecture, integration patterns, and master data management strategy.
- Security Architecture Design
Real estate companies face increasing cyber threats targeting property management systems and customer data. How would you design a comprehensive security architecture implementing zero-trust principles, network segmentation, and data protection? Include specific security controls for IoT devices and customer-facing applications.
- Network Infrastructure Modernization
How would you design the network infrastructure to support 50+ distributed properties with requirements for high availability, secure connectivity, and centralized management? Detail your approach to SD-WAN, VPN connectivity, and network monitoring.
- Disaster Recovery and Business Continuity
Property management systems are mission-critical for operations. How would you design a disaster recovery architecture that ensures business continuity? Include specific RTO/RPO targets, backup strategies, and failover mechanisms for critical systems.
- Application Modernization Roadmap
PrimeRealty operates multiple legacy applications for property management, sales, and customer service. How would you design an application modernization strategy, potentially leveraging microservices architecture and containerization? Include considerations for API management and service mesh implementation.
- Infrastructure as Code Implementation
Mr. Sharma wants repeatable, consistent infrastructure deployments across new properties. How would you implement Infrastructure as Code (IaC) practices using tools like Terraform or Ansible? Include CI/CD pipeline design and environment management strategies.
- Monitoring and Observability Framework
Outline a comprehensive monitoring and observability strategy for PrimeRealty's distributed infrastructure. Include specific tools, metrics, logging strategies, and alerting mechanisms that provide visibility across cloud and on-premises environments.
- Cost Optimization Strategy
PrimeRealty's Vision 2035 requires significant infrastructure investment. How would you design a cost optimization framework that balances performance, scalability, and budget constraints? Include FinOps practices, resource tagging strategies, and cost allocation models across different properties and business units.
